Abstract :
This paper is mostly historical but it also describes some technical contributions by Jim James that were considered very useful at that time. The historical aspects include fundamental research which contributed materially to our understanding of the radiation mechanism on dielectric rod antennas. His deep intuitive understanding both at a practical and theoretical level enabled James to clarify antenna design and radiation behaviour of many other emergent antenna technologies, such as microstrip antennas, dielectric resonator antennas and other novel antennas. It is interesting that the results of these works still continue to be used today.
